Pleuronectidae (Righteye flounders), subfamily: Pleuronectinae |
100 cm SL (male/unsexed); max.weight: 8,500.0 g; max. reported age: 33 years |
demersal; depth range 20 - 1200 m |
North Pacific: Sea of Japan and the Sea of Okhotsk north to the Anadyr Gulf, through the eastern Bering Sea to the Aleutian Islands and the Shelikof Strait in Alaska. |
Dorsal spines (total): 0-0; Dorsal soft rays (total): 98-116; Anal spines: 0-0; Anal soft rays: 76-94. Mouth very large; gill rakers slender; caudal fin strong and lunate (Ref. 559). |
